Garth Brooks And Troy Aikman Unveil Playroom For Sick Kids
The singer and the former Dallas Cowboy visited children on Tuesday at Cook Children's Medical Center in Fort Worth, where they opened an updated therapeutic playroom called the Zone Playroom, formerly known as Aikman's End Zone.
Aikman says, "We wanted to do something for them because they spend all day in their bedrooms and we just wanted to get them out of there so they could have a little bit of fun."
